Editorial Summary

Ditanium and PAX FOUR are both electronic vaporizers, but they target different priorities. PAX FOUR is usually the lower-cost pick at $250, around $49 below Ditanium. Ditanium has the quicker listed heat-up profile, which can matter for shorter sessions.

Comparison FAQs

What is the biggest difference between the Ditanium and the PAX FOUR?

The biggest practical difference is form factor: these aren't the same kind of device. Ditanium is a desktop, PAX FOUR is a portable. Pick based on whether you want something portable or something stationary.

Which is cheaper, the Ditanium or the PAX FOUR?

PAX FOUR is the cheaper option at $250 compared with $299 for the Ditanium, about $49 less. Live retailer pricing can shift, so confirm before buying.

Which heats up faster, the Ditanium or the PAX FOUR?

Ditanium reaches session-ready temperature in ~30 Seconds, while the PAX FOUR takes 55-70 seconds. That's roughly 33 seconds quicker on the Ditanium, which is useful if you want shorter, on-demand sessions.

What's the difference in heating between the Ditanium and the PAX FOUR?

Ditanium uses convection heating, while the PAX FOUR uses hybrid (conduction and convection). Heating style influences flavor profile, vapor density, and how forgiving the device is to draw technique.

Does the Ditanium or the PAX FOUR hold more flower?

Ditanium has the larger chamber at ~0.5 grams, versus ~0.3g on the PAX FOUR. A bigger bowl means fewer reloads on long sessions; a smaller one suits microdosing and quicker bowls.

Is the Ditanium or the PAX FOUR better for home versus on-the-go use?

PAX FOUR is the take-anywhere choice. It's a portable, battery-powered unit, while the Ditanium is built for home use, where bigger heaters, AC power, and larger chambers make sense.

Can I use concentrates with the Ditanium or the PAX FOUR?

Only the Ditanium supports concentrates out of the box. The PAX FOUR is dry-herb-only by design.
